When I'm unfamiliar with an area I like to get car insurance quotes to get a gauge. The higher the rate, the worse the neighborhood. So far in my life this method has been very reliable.

95202 $843
95203 $873
95204 $873
95205 $1,074
95206 $869
95207 $890
95209 $866
95210 $1,123
95211 $822
95212 $949
95215 $930
95219 $818
